秦亞萍,李曉麗
(開(kāi)封大學(xué) 電子電氣工程學(xué)院,河南 開(kāi)封 475004)
十字路口的交通信號(hào)燈與我們的日常生活息息相關(guān),它起著規(guī)范行人過(guò)馬路和車輛行駛的重要作用,其控制效率需要不斷提高.隨著信息技術(shù)的快速發(fā)展,交通信號(hào)燈控制系統(tǒng)不斷得到完善,新的控制方式不斷產(chǎn)生.交通信號(hào)燈的控制系統(tǒng)可以采用數(shù)字電路來(lái)設(shè)計(jì),交通信號(hào)燈也可由單片機(jī)來(lái)控制.數(shù)字電路結(jié)構(gòu)復(fù)雜,檢修起來(lái)比較麻煩;單片機(jī)控制系統(tǒng)的抗干擾能力差,系統(tǒng)不穩(wěn)定.PLC的軟硬件系統(tǒng)功能強(qiáng)大、可靠性強(qiáng),邏輯編程方法簡(jiǎn)單,用它開(kāi)發(fā)出較為復(fù)雜的控制系統(tǒng)不是太難[1].PLC系統(tǒng)擁有豐富的擴(kuò)展模塊和較強(qiáng)的聯(lián)網(wǎng)能力,應(yīng)用范圍廣泛[2].實(shí)踐證明,用PLC控制交通信號(hào)燈是可行的,基于PLC的交通信號(hào)燈控制系統(tǒng)的穩(wěn)定運(yùn)行是能夠?qū)崿F(xiàn)的.
對(duì)十字路口交通信號(hào)燈的控制系統(tǒng)有如下要求:(1)南北紅燈亮25秒,東西綠燈亮20秒.東西和南北的LED數(shù)碼管開(kāi)始25秒倒計(jì)時(shí),到20秒時(shí),東西綠燈閃亮,閃亮3秒后熄滅,在東西綠燈熄滅后,東西黃燈閃亮,并維持2秒,2秒后,東西黃燈熄滅,東西紅燈亮起,同時(shí),南北紅燈熄滅,綠燈亮起,東西和南北的LED數(shù)碼管又開(kāi)始25秒倒計(jì)時(shí).(2)東西紅燈亮25秒.南北綠燈亮20秒,閃亮3秒后熄滅,南北黃燈亮,維持2秒后熄滅,這時(shí)南北紅燈亮,東西綠燈亮.(3)依照上述時(shí)間順序,周而復(fù)始.
本設(shè)計(jì)中,輸入端口有“啟動(dòng)”和“停止”這兩個(gè);輸出端口有南北、東西向的紅綠黃信號(hào)燈(共6個(gè)輸出口)和南北、東西向的四個(gè)數(shù)碼管(共32個(gè)輸出口),共計(jì)38個(gè).本設(shè)計(jì)中,采用S7-200 CPU224加4個(gè)數(shù)字量擴(kuò)展模塊EM233,共有46個(gè)輸入端口和42個(gè)輸出端口,滿足端口需求.
十字路口交通信號(hào)燈控制系統(tǒng)的接線如圖1所示.
圖1 十字路口交通信號(hào)燈控制系統(tǒng)的接線
輸入端:?jiǎn)?dòng)按鈕SB1、停止按鈕SB2分別分配地址I0.0和I0.1.
輸出端:南北紅燈LED1分配Q0.0;
南北綠燈LED2分配Q0.1;
南北黃燈LED3分配Q0.2;
東西紅燈LED4分配Q0.3;
東西綠燈LED5分配Q0.4;
東西黃燈LED6分配Q0.5;
南北向個(gè)位數(shù)碼管分配給地址QB2;
南北向十位數(shù)碼管分配給地址QB3;
東西向個(gè)位數(shù)碼管分配給地址QB4;
東西向十位數(shù)碼管分配給地址QB5.
根據(jù)控制要求,設(shè)計(jì)控制流程.如圖2所示.
圖2 十字路口交通信號(hào)燈控制系統(tǒng)控制流程
十字路口交通信號(hào)燈時(shí)序如圖3所示.
圖3 十字路口交通信號(hào)燈控制系統(tǒng)時(shí)序
采用S7-200PLC編程軟件STEP_7-MicroWIN_V4_SP3編寫(xiě)十字路口交通信號(hào)燈控制程序.圖4為部分梯形圖.
圖4 十字路口交通信號(hào)燈部分梯形圖
將程序下載至PLC.如果將來(lái)需要修改同行時(shí)間或其他方面,修改好程序后重新下載就可以了.
為了實(shí)現(xiàn)監(jiān)控室對(duì)交通路口的監(jiān)控,本文設(shè)計(jì)了一個(gè)觸摸屏遠(yuǎn)程監(jiān)控系統(tǒng).本設(shè)計(jì)中的觸摸屏為西門子Smart Line系列7寸屏,該款觸摸屏分辨率高,穩(wěn)定性強(qiáng).
監(jiān)控畫(huà)面組態(tài)如圖5、圖6、圖7所示.
圖5 遠(yuǎn)程監(jiān)控系統(tǒng)主畫(huà)面
圖6 遠(yuǎn)程監(jiān)控系統(tǒng)畫(huà)面(1)
圖7 遠(yuǎn)程監(jiān)控系統(tǒng)畫(huà)面(2)
觸摸屏具有運(yùn)行狀態(tài)顯示清楚明了的優(yōu)點(diǎn).通過(guò)觸摸屏上顯示的符號(hào)或文字,我們可以實(shí)現(xiàn)對(duì)PLC的遠(yuǎn)程控制,人機(jī)交互更為便捷.
實(shí)驗(yàn)結(jié)果表明,本文設(shè)計(jì)的十字路口交通信號(hào)燈控制系統(tǒng)運(yùn)行可靠,程序修改方便靈活,該控制系統(tǒng)可應(yīng)用于各個(gè)交通路口.所采用的觸摸屏遠(yuǎn)程監(jiān)控設(shè)計(jì),能使工作人員實(shí)時(shí)掌握信號(hào)燈的現(xiàn)場(chǎng)狀態(tài).該設(shè)計(jì)的不足之處還在于交通信號(hào)燈變化時(shí)間的固定.根據(jù)人流量、車流量來(lái)自動(dòng)調(diào)整東西、南北向紅綠黃燈的時(shí)間,這是我們追求的目標(biāo).